相关文章
Kotlin判空辅助工具
1)?.操作符
//执行逻辑
if (person ! null) {person.doSomething()
}
//表达式
person?.doSomething()
2)?:操作符
//执行逻辑
val c if (a ! null) {a
} else {b
}
//表达式
val c a ?: b
3)!!表达式
var message: String? &qu…
建站知识
2025/5/6 16:03:31
在FreeBSD下安装Ollama并体验DeepSeek r1大模型
在FreeBSD下安装Ollama并体验DeepSeek r1大模型 在FreeBSD下安装Ollama
直接使用pkg安装即可:
sudo pkg install ollama
安装完成后,提示:
You installed ollama: the AI model runner.
To run ollama, plese open 2 terminals. 1. In t…
建站知识
2025/5/10 0:15:31
双指针(典型算法思想)——OJ例题算法解析思路
目录
一、283. 移动零 - 力扣(LeetCode)
1. 问题分析
2. 算法思路
3. 代码逐行解析
4. 示例运行
5. 时间复杂度与空间复杂度
6. 总结
二、1089. 复写零 - 力扣(LeetCode) 1. 问题分析
2. 算法思路
3. 代码逐行解析
4. …
建站知识
2025/5/5 19:40:43
【Day29 LeetCode】动态规划DP
一、动态规划DP
1、不同路径 62
首先是dp数组,dp[i][j]表示从起点(0, 0)到达当前位置(i, j)的路径数,转移方程从只能向下和向右移动可知,初始化边界可直观推出第一行和第一列上的位置只有一条路径。
class Solution {
public:int uniquePa…
建站知识
2025/5/10 14:46:21
(三)Session和Cookie讲解
目录
一、前备知识点
(1)静态网页
(2)动态网页
(3)无状态HTTP
二、Session和Cookie
三、Session
四、Cookie
(1)维持过程
(2)结构 正式开始说 Sessi…
建站知识
2025/5/10 3:06:43
基于SpringBoot的阳光幼儿园管理系统
作者:计算机学姐 开发技术:SpringBoot、SSM、Vue、MySQL、JSP、ElementUI、Python、小程序等,“文末源码”。 专栏推荐:前后端分离项目源码、SpringBoot项目源码、Vue项目源码、SSM项目源码、微信小程序源码 精品专栏:…
建站知识
2025/5/12 18:14:54
分布式系统相关面试题收集
目录
什么是分布式系统,以及它有哪些主要特性? 分布式系统中如何保证数据的一致性? 解释一下CAP理论,并说明在分布式系统中如何权衡CAP三者? 什么是分布式事务,以及它的实现方式有哪些? 什么是…
建站知识
2025/5/14 18:55:52
树和图的实现与应用:C语言实践详解
树和图的实现与应用:C语言实践详解
树和图是两种重要的非线性数据结构,在计算机科学中有着广泛的应用。从基本的二叉树到复杂的图算法(如最短路径和最小生成树),这些结构能够帮助我们高效解决实际问题。本文将从基础出发,逐步深入,讲解如何用C语言实现树和图,并探讨其…
建站知识
2025/5/6 1:28:01